Lotus Digital Instrument Pack is the Ideal Track-Day Tool
Lotus is a brand well known for finding ways to go faster. The very first Lotus was a modified Austin 7 which founder Colin Chapman built to be lighter and more powerful, to compete in trials racing. Chapman’s principles guide Lotus to this day, with even the all-electric Evija being both as light and as powerful as possible.

Rolls-Royce Wraith Kryptos is the World’s Most Secretive Car
If you happen to be particularly wealthy but also a code-breaking genius, Rolls-Royce has created the perfect car for you. The Rolls-Royce Wraith Kryptos Collection is a strictly limited edition run of 50 cars that contain a secret code known only to two people in the world.
